Experience has shown that joists designed to the code minimum live load deflection l 360 will result in a floor which may not meet the expectations of some end users.
Usually shear governs for short spans and bending governs on longer spans.

A uniform load rating on a beam can easily be translated into what an equivalent maximum point load can be.

Common sense tells you that large floor joists can carry more load and spacing joists closer together also increases the load bearing capacity of a floor.

Floor performance is greatly influenced by the stiffness of the floor joists.

For example a floor joist at 16 spacing s that can carry 53 pounds per linear foot would translate into a 318 pound single point load at its center.
